Size of typical cold and frozen food vending machines

Overall dimensions

When considering the size of cold and frozen food vending machines, it’s important to first look at their overall dimensions. These machines can vary in size, but typically they are designed to be compact and space-efficient. The overall dimensions of a vending machine can range from around 72 inches to 90 inches in height, 36 inches to 48 inches in width, and 30 inches to 36 inches in depth. These measurements allow for easy placement in a variety of locations, both indoors and outdoors.

Internal storage capacity

The internal storage capacity of cold and frozen food vending machines is another important factor to consider. The size of the storage space can vary depending on the specific model and design of the vending machine. On average, these machines can hold anywhere from 150 to 500 individual food items. This allows for a range of product offerings and ensures that customers have a variety of options to choose from.

Weight

The weight of a cold and frozen food vending machine can also vary depending on its size and construction. On average, these machines can weigh anywhere from 400 to 800 pounds. This weight takes into account the materials used in the construction of the machine, as well as the internal refrigeration system. It is important to consider the weight of the machine when planning for installation and transportation.

Display area size

The display area of a cold and frozen food vending machine is an important aspect to consider. This is the area where the products are showcased and made visible to potential customers. The size of the display area can vary depending on the specific machine, but typically ranges from 20 inches to 30 inches in width and 30 inches to 40 inches in height. This allows ample space for product visibility and ensures that customers can easily see and select their desired items.

Average dimensions of cold and frozen food vending machines

Width

The width of a cold and frozen food vending machine typically ranges from 36 inches to 48 inches. This measurement includes the overall width of the machine, including any additional components such as cooling systems or storage compartments.

Height

The height of a cold and frozen food vending machine can range from 72 inches to 90 inches. This measurement takes into account the total height of the machine, including any additional height required for the refrigeration units or display areas.

Depth

The depth of a cold and frozen food vending machine generally falls between 30 inches to 36 inches. This measurement includes the overall depth of the machine, including any space required for internal storage or cooling systems.
